Reforj Debuts Rixels Texture Tech to Distinguish It From Minecraft

TL;DR Summary
Ex-Minecraft porting studio 4J Studios’ Reforj has an eighth update introducing a new texture system called Rixels, which breaks voxel faces into smaller 2D pixel blocks to boost texture detail, per-pixel lighting, and animation flexibility, helping differentiate Reforj from Minecraft; the tech also promises reduced texture storage and moves the game closer to a distinct Xbox sandbox experience.
